About Nathan Corbett

Nathan Corbett is a scholar working on Pulmonary and Respiratory Medicine, Immunology, Organic Chemistry, Molecular Biology and Political Science and International Relations, having authored 8 papers that have together received 342 indexed citations. Recurring topics across this work include Neonatal Respiratory Health Research (2 papers), Immune Response and Inflammation (2 papers), Circadian rhythm and melatonin (1 paper), Telomeres, Telomerase, and Senescence (1 paper), Flame retardant materials and properties (1 paper), School Choice and Performance (1 paper), Genetics, Aging, and Longevity in Model Organisms (1 paper) and dental development and anomalies (1 paper). The work is most often cited by research in Aging (8 citations), Immunology (81 citations), Biological Psychiatry (8 citations), Genetics (69 citations) and Genetics (19 citations). Nathan Corbett has collaborated with scholars based in Canada, United States and Italy. Frequent co-authors include Edgardo S. Fortuno, Stuart E. Turvey, Tobias R. Kollmann, Curtis R. French, Andrew J. Waskiewicz, Natalie Hawkins, Michael A. Walter, Marc Abitbol, Steven G. Self and W. Ted Allison. Their work appears in journals such as Genes and Immunity, Expert Opinion on Drug Discovery, European Neuropsychopharmacology, PLoS ONE and Macromolecules.
